The next Exeter Board meeting will feature a discussion on cycling in the city.

Exeter residents are invited to attend the meeting and hear about Devon County Council’s Exeter Cycling Campaign.

The evening will also focus on Exeter City Futures, their cycling strategy and future challenges for increasing cycle use in the city.

There will be an opportunity to present questions as part of the discussion following the initial presentations.

The meeting takes place at 5.30pm on Thursday 2 February at the Civic Centre in Paris Street. The Exeter Board is a joint Exeter City Council and Devon County Council meeting.
